A tax-equivalent yield is the return a taxable investment needs to generate to match what you would earn on a tax-free investment. The formula compares the return of the tax-free investment...

Tax to gross domestic product (GDP) ratio is total tax revenue as a percentage of GDP, which indicates the share of a country's output that is collected by the government through taxes. It can be regarded as one measure of the degree to which the government controls the economy's resources. A tax lien is a legal claim placed on an individual’s property by the local or municipal government when the owner hasn’t paid a property tax debt.

Stocks are more likely to produce long-term capital gains—and the associated tax liability—than bonds. However, bond and bond fund interest falls under income for tax purposes, which adds to an investor's taxable income. The IRS taxes long-term capital gains (gains on the sale of assets held more than one year) at lower rates …

As is true of any tax, property tax yields can be increased by either increasing tax rates or reducing losses arising from evasion and maladministration. In the case of the property tax, there is a strong argument for beginning with the latter. Efforts to increase rates alone would exaggerateThu, 11/30/2023 - 12:00. The Taxable Equivalent Yield is the yield required from a fully taxable investment to earn the same after tax income as you would with a tax-exempt municipal bond. Use this TEY calculator to compare the yields of fully taxable investments with the yields of tax-exempt municipal bonds. Learn about the tax lien schemes, seminars, and scams now!!Dec 9, 2022 · Tax-equivalent yield is a calculation investors use to compare yields on a taxable bond versus a tax-exempt bond. Corporate bond interest payments are taxed as income. Treasury securities are subject to federal income tax but exempt from state and local taxes. Municipal bonds usually are exempt from federal taxes.
